What is a VRChat rig and what makes it different from a standard Blender rig?
A vrchat rig must pass VRChat SDK humanoid avatar validation — correct bone naming, muscle limits, and blendshape naming for visemes are all required before the avatar can be uploaded.
What are visemes and why does the vrchat avatar rig need them?
Visemes are blendshapes that drive mouth shapes for lip sync — without correct viseme setup the vrchat rig avatar appears mute during voice chat in VRChat.
What is PhysBone and how is it set up on the vr avatar rig?
PhysBone is VRChat's built-in physics system for cloth, hair, tails, and ears — configured per-bone chain with correct gravity, spring, and collision settings in the vrchat setup.
